Micro Bio LLC provides microbiological testing services for pharmaceutical, cosmetic, and water industries.
Micro Bio LLC delivers professional, accurate, and timely microbiology testing services. We are an ISO/IEC 17025 accredited, MDEQ certified, and FDA inspected facility found here locally in Troy, Michigan. Our focus is on providing our customers with reliable and consistent service. Kroger ground beef among 35,000 lbs. in meat recalled More than 35,000 lbs. of raw ground beef have been recalled by JBS USA, Inc. because it could be contaminated with hard plastics, the USDA reports.

Ecoli O157:H7 outbreak linked to lettuce for 2nd time in 6 months!
E. coli outbreak: If you have store-bought chopped romaine lettuce at home, including salads and salad mixes with chopped romaine, don’t eat it and throw it away. If you don’t know if the lettuce is romaine, don’t eat it. go.usa.gov/xQbwT
